Version: 6.3.1
Public Member Functions | Private Attributes

ICoCo.MEDField Class Reference

#include <ICoCoMEDField.hxx>

Inheritance diagram for ICoCo.MEDField:
Inheritance graph

Public Member Functions

 MEDField ()
 MEDField (ParaMEDMEM::MEDCouplingUMesh *mesh, ParaMEDMEM::MEDCouplingFieldDouble *field)
 MEDField (TrioField &)
virtual ~MEDField ()
ParaMEDMEM::MEDCouplingFieldDoublegetField () const
ParaMEDMEM::MEDCouplingUMeshgetMesh () const

Private Attributes

ParaMEDMEM::MEDCouplingUMesh_mesh
ParaMEDMEM::MEDCouplingFieldDouble_field

Constructor & Destructor Documentation

ICoCo.MEDField.MEDField ( )
ICoCo.MEDField::MEDField ( ParaMEDMEM::MEDCouplingUMesh mesh,
ParaMEDMEM::MEDCouplingFieldDouble field 
)

Constructor directly attaching a MEDCouplingUMesh and a MEDCouplingFieldDouble the object does not take the control the objects pointed by mesh and field.

References ICoCo.MEDField._field, ICoCo.MEDField._mesh, and ParaMEDMEM.RefCountObject.incrRef().

ICoCo.MEDField::MEDField ( TrioField triofield)

References ICoCo.TrioField._connectivity, ICoCo.TrioField._coords, ICoCo.TrioField._field, ICoCo.MEDField._field, ICoCo.TrioField._itnumber, ICoCo.MEDField._mesh, ICoCo.TrioField._mesh_dim, ICoCo.TrioField._nb_elems, ICoCo.TrioField._nb_field_components, ICoCo.TrioField._nbnodes, ICoCo.TrioField._nodes_per_elem, ICoCo.TrioField._space_dim, ICoCo.TrioField._time1, ICoCo.TrioField._type, ParaMEDMEM.DataArrayDouble.alloc(), ParaMEDMEM.MEDCouplingUMesh.allocateCells(), testRenumbering.conn, ParaMEDMEM.ConservativeVolumic, ParaMEDMEM.RefCountObject.decrRef(), ParaMEDMEM.MEDCouplingUMesh.finishInsertingCells(), ParaMEDMEM.MEDCouplingField.getName(), ICoCo.Field.getName(), ParaMEDMEM.MEDCouplingFieldDouble.getNumberOfTuples(), ParaMEDMEM.DataArrayDouble.getPointer(), ParaMEDMEM.MEDCouplingUMesh.insertNextCell(), Med_Gen_test.meshName, ICoCo.TrioField.nb_values(), ParaMEDMEM.MEDCouplingFieldDouble.New(), ParaMEDMEM.DataArrayDouble.New(), ParaMEDMEM.MEDCouplingUMesh.New(), INTERP_KERNEL.NORM_HEXA8, INTERP_KERNEL.NORM_QUAD4, INTERP_KERNEL.NORM_TETRA4, INTERP_KERNEL.NORM_TRI3, ParaMEDMEM.ON_CELLS, ParaMEDMEM.ON_NODES, ParaMEDMEM.ONE_TIME, ParaMEDMEM.MEDCouplingFieldDouble.setArray(), ParaMEDMEM.MEDCouplingPointSet.setCoords(), ParaMEDMEM.DataArrayDouble.setIJ(), ParaMEDMEM.MEDCouplingField.setMesh(), ParaMEDMEM.MEDCouplingUMesh.setMeshDimension(), ParaMEDMEM.MEDCouplingMesh.setName(), ParaMEDMEM.MEDCouplingField.setName(), ParaMEDMEM.MEDCouplingFieldDouble.setNature(), and ParaMEDMEM.MEDCouplingFieldDouble.setTime().

ICoCo.MEDField::~MEDField ( ) [virtual]

Member Function Documentation

ParaMEDMEM::MEDCouplingFieldDouble* ICoCo.MEDField.getField ( ) const

References ICoCo.MEDField._field.

ParaMEDMEM::MEDCouplingUMesh* ICoCo.MEDField.getMesh ( ) const

References ICoCo.MEDField._mesh.


Field Documentation

Copyright © 2007-2011 CEA/DEN, EDF R&D, OPEN CASCADE
Copyright © 2003-2007 OPEN CASCADE, EADS/CCR, LIP6, CEA/DEN, CEDRAT, EDF R&D, LEG, PRINCIPIA R&D, BUREAU VERITAS